Output 399f78ce28b265a4928dee8f186b415d00f096a57259d0c71eabf9d7e222fdbb:4

value
20131008996
script pubkey
OP_0 OP_PUSHBYTES_20 df2c5930e0a2f9656b8b5111758f74da2f084439
address
ltc1qmuk9jv8q5tuk26ut2yghtrm5mghss3peyma8la
transaction
399f78ce28b265a4928dee8f186b415d00f096a57259d0c71eabf9d7e222fdbb
spent
true